1. Comprehensive Patient Assessment Is Crucial

Before any dental implant procedure, a thorough patient assessment is paramount. This process begins with an extensive medical history review, which helps identify any underlying conditions that could impact the surgical outcome. Conditions such as diabetes, autoimmune diseases, or cardiovascular issues can pose significant risks, necessitating tailored approaches to treatment.
Further, a detailed dental evaluation, including imaging studies such as X-rays or CT scans, is essential for understanding the patients bone structure and defining the ideal implant site. This imaging aids in detecting any anatomical anomalies that could hinder placement and success. Additionally, assessing the patient’s oral hygiene practices will provide insights into their ability to maintain their implants post-surgery.
Finally, an understanding of the patient’s psychological readiness and expectations is key. Engaging in open discussions regarding the procedure can alleviate anxiety and ensure the patient is well-informed about the anticipated results and recovery process. An empowered patient is more likely to engage in post-operative care effectively, contributing to the success of the implantation.
2. Detailed Treatment Planning Enhances Success
Creating a robust treatment plan is vital for successful dental implantation. This plan should include not only the choice of implants and surgical techniques but also consider any additional procedures such as bone grafting or sinus lifts necessary for adequate implant support. Collaborating with a multi-disciplinary team can enhance the planning phase, allowing for a more comprehensive approach tailored to the patient’s unique needs.
Moreover, it is essential to establish the timeline for the treatment process, accounting for healing phases and possible complications. Planning should also integrate patient preferences and financial constraints, ensuring that the selected approach is manageable for the patient. This level of customization will enhance patient satisfaction and commitment to the treatment.
Lastly, the involvement of digital technologies, such as 3D modeling and virtual simulations, can facilitate better planning and execution of the procedure. These tools allow practitioners to visualize the desired outcomes accurately and adjust their techniques accordingly, maximizing the likelihood of successful implantation.
3. Adherence to Surgical Protocols is Essential
During the surgical stage of dental implantation, adherence to established protocols is critical. Ensuring a sterile environment, utilizing appropriate anesthetics, and following stringent procedural guidelines help minimize the risk of infection and complications. The surgeons expertise in handling various scenarios during surgery can significantly influence the outcome.
In addition to a clean workspace, proper implant placement is crucial. Achieving optimal angles and depths requires precision, which can be aided by the use of guides and templates developed during the planning phase. This technique not only enhances accuracy but also reduces surgery time, further decreasing patient discomfort and the risk of complications.
Post-surgery, monitoring is equally important. Implementing a policy for immediate follow-up appointments ensures any signs of complications are promptly addressed. Developing a clear protocol for handling unexpected issues can further safeguard the patients health and contribute to a successful overall experience.
4. Rigorous Post-Operative Care for Recovery
Following a successful surgery, post-operative care plays a significant role in the longevity of dental implants. Providing the patient with comprehensive aftercare instructions, including pain management strategies, dietary restrictions, and oral hygiene practices, is essential for an uneventful recovery. Educating the patient on the signs of complications, such as swelling or unusual pain, can empower them to seek timely intervention if needed.
Regular follow-up appointments after the procedure are crucial for monitoring the healing process. During these visits, practitioners can assess the integration of the implant with the bone, ensuring that the body is responding well to the procedure. It also reinforces the significance of continued care and supports patients in maintaining optimal oral health.
Finally, encouraging a long-term follow-up schedule serves not only to ensure the sustainability of the implants but also reinforces the importance of regular dental visits. Continuous patient education about the caring for dental implants will contribute to their durability and the patients overall oral health.
